“The Great Unknown!”

In "The Great Unknown!", the Challengers venture into Cold War-era Siberia on a high-stakes mission to recover a missing atom bomb, stumbling into a clash of ideologies and unexpected allies. With a mysterious Communist agent named "Nasty" and a White Russian princess named Zarra wielding mutant monsters and a troll army, the mission takes a wild turn when the bomb detonates and secrets unravel. Written by Karl Kesel and illustrated by Art Adams, with inks by Kesel and colors by Zylonol, this 80-page giant features a cover by Sean Phillips that captures the era’s tension and flair.

Back during the Cold War, the Challengers slip into Siberia to find a missing atom bomb. They find it, and a female Communist agent named "Nasty" with whom Ace fearlessly flirts. Also a White Russian princess, Zarra, who stole the bomb to wipe out Communism. Along with her giant mutant monsters and army of trolls. Zarra gets shot, the bomb gets detonated, "Nasty" gets away - and Ace daydreams about the "Commie calendar girl".
